It used to be thought that adults
had limited learning capacity, hence the adage, ‘you
can’t teach an old dog new tricks’. Research
has shown this is incorrect. Their ability to learn
decreases very slightly with age. What is important
is the will to learn. If we have faith in ourselves
we can achieve amazing things.
Adult education has two strands. There is the personal
satisfaction in following a course of study and it
can be for pleasure or because we want to take up
a particular type of work. |
|
Secondly there is the demonstration to employers that
the individual has the capacity and willingness to learn
new skills and develop professionally. This raises self
esteem and professional confidence. To be up to date with
the elements of our work means being able to do a better
job and see possibilities for ourselves or our employers
because we are informed.
Another part of this is that to learn something means you begin to change ideas
because you see possibilities that were not visible before
and because the sheer experience of new material alters
perceptions of what is possible. For many this is an uncomfortable
process but if you can show you are able to be flexible
and improve skills you become a valuable member of any organization.
Openness to ideas and better working practices helps employers
to take their business forward and is appreciated. The praise
received for achievement is always welcome.

Online Learning for Adults
The benefits of online and distance learning is that being
able to continue to earn a living can fit in with other
commitments. It also means carefully thought out planning
for how the course is to be covered. This requires discipline
and organization to blend the needs of the course with the
needs of family life and work. The trick is to understand
what the course covers, then take it step by step. Concentrating
on one thing at once stops the process from being overwhelming
and it becomes achievable as each stage is mastered. Even
if the individual dislikes routine, having one to cover
the reading, write the assignments and take in the information,
is essential. The bonus is that it is only for a short time,
and all being well, the person can then relax the discipline
because they are using their learning in their work.
Another aspect of working for qualifications at home is
that there are no university living expenses to cover. The
cost of the course and the materials such as books are the
biggest expense. If the initial research for the right course
to cover what the person wants to study is done well, a
reputable supplier will offer all the challenges and structure
needed.
For some there will be the opportunity to leave work and
study full time for a course. Some companies support this
and there are often grants and funds available from charities
but they require care to search out. It also depends on
where you live.
